Try these outdoor activities to help with your anxiety
Being outside surrounded by nature can really enhance wellbeing. Just think about how you felt the last time you were out surrounded by greenery. In fact, studies show that being in nature or anywhere thereโs a green environment improves your mood drastically, writes fitness coach Heidi Rosenberg.
Exercise is so important and not just for your physical health, but also your mental health. Doing a vigorous workout every day helps reduce your anxiety symptoms for hours and has been proven to have long-lasting effects. Setting up an outdoor gym is a great idea if you want to decrease your anxiety symptoms.
You donโt even need it to be big, either. Just going to purchase a couple of small and portable pieces of gym equipment can do just the trick. Create a workout routine that works for you while taking into consideration all the gym equipment you just purchased.
Having an outdoor gym area in your backyard can be more beneficial for your anxiety because youโre not just working out to help with your symptoms. You are also surrounded by all the lovely green scenery. Itโs a double dose of all-natural medicine, and thatโs the best kind.
Going out for a bike ride is a great way to reduce your anxiety symptoms because it boosts your mood and decreases the feelings which cause anxiety and stress. Even if you go for just a short bike ride around town it can do so much good to your mind and body. What helps as well is having a good biker buddy with you to keep you company on your ride. This could be a good supportive friend or a pet who also loves going outside.
Just like the above physical activities that Iโve mentioned, if you donโt have a bike or a backyard, you can always go out in nature and enjoy a nice refreshing run or walk. Doing this also releases endorphins to your brain, which puts you in that โfeel-good moodโ state of mind. Plus, you can do this activity whenever you get free time from your busy day. Having people tag along with you or your pet can be just as fun and keep you company.
Finding a nice quiet spot away from everything is an excellent place to start when trying to meditate outside. Meditation is a mindful and peaceful way to relax the mind and ease away anxiety.
If meditation isnโt quite for you, then thereโs a different type of meditation you can try. Itโs called forest bathing, and it comes from Japan. To put it simply, forest bathing is just talking a slow walk through the forest. Not thinking of anything or doing anything (besides walking calmly) is just being. Being present in the moment and focusing on that. Studies show that forest bathing helps slow the heart rate and reduce blood pressure. It brings a wave of positive emotions through you and pushes away any negative feelings and thoughts.
Starting to do yoga, in general, is always good and healthy for you, but outdoor yoga is even better! As you are calmly going through your yoga routine and focusing on your breath, think of all the fresh air youโre breathing in from all the nature surrounding you. Even if youโre not the most flexible person, there are plenty of yoga routines out there for beginners. One style of yoga that is best recommended to reduce anxiety is Hatha yoga. Hatha yoga has a slower pace and more effortless movements, which beginners will like.
